Description
Lemon Bottle is not a peptide; it is a South Korean lipolytic injectable solution designed for targeted fat reduction using enzymes and other compounds.
What Lemon Bottle Is
Lemon Bottle is an injectable fat-dissolving solution that targets localized fat deposits through a combination of riboflavin (vitamin B2), bromelain, and lecithin seekpeptides.com+2. Unlike peptides, which influence hormone production or metabolic signaling, Lemon Bottle works via direct enzymatic and chemical action on fat cells seekpeptides.com. Bromelain, derived from pineapple stems, breaks down structural proteins around fat cells, lecithin emulsifies fat to disrupt cell membranes, and riboflavin supports fat metabolism while giving the solution its yellow color peptidesupplierphilippines.com+1.
Mechanism of Action
- Bromelain: Proteolytic enzyme that digests proteins in the extracellular matrix, weakening fat cell membranes and reducing inflammation seekpeptides.com+1.
- Lecithin: Emulsifies fat, allowing fat cell contents to spill out and be metabolized peptidesupplierphilippines.com+1.
- Riboflavin (Vitamin B2): Acts as a co-factor in fat metabolism, enhancing lipolysis and providing anti-inflammatory effects www.lemonbottle.us.
This threefold mechanism targets fat at multiple levels: membrane disruption, protein clearance, and metabolic processing of released fatty acids peptidesupplierphilippines.com.
Usage and Treatment Areas
Lemon Bottle is used for facial and body contouring, including the chin, jowls, abdomen, flanks, thighs, and arms medsupplysolutions.com. Dosages vary by area: 0.3–0.5 mL per point for the face and 1–3 mL per point for the body, with treatment intervals of 2–4 weeks for the face and 7–10 days for the body medsupplysolutions.com. Results typically stabilize 6–12 weeks after the final session. Proper injection technique is critical to avoid complications such as nerve damage or uneven fat reduction medsupplysolutions.com.
Safety Considerations
- Allergy screening is essential, particularly for bromelain (pineapple) and citrus sensitivities medsupplysolutions.com.
- Lemon Bottle is not FDA-approved and lacks peer-reviewed clinical validation medsupplysolutions.com.
- Patients should follow post-treatment care, including hydration, avoiding massage for 48 hours, and using cold compresses to reduce swelling medsupplysolutions.com.
Comparison to Peptides
While some fat-loss peptides exist, they work by modulating hormones or metabolic pathways, unlike Lemon Bottle, which directly dissolves fat cells seekpeptides.com. This distinction affects both efficacy and regulatory oversight.
